SW 6410

Assessment and Diagnostic Process in Social Work ((3))

Catalog description

The primary focus of this course is on the development of assessment and diagnostic skills using a competency-based biopsychosocial assessment model. The DSM 5TR and ICD 10 are used as an organizing framework to provide a context and a backdrop to explore behavioral health disorders. Strengths and limitations of this framework are examined. The importance of context including the impact of culture, poverty, race/ethnicity, age, and other factors is emphasized. Ethical issues related to assessment and diagnoses are integrated throughout the course.
